Patch Diff
Unauthenticated network-adjacent (over-the-air) OOB read/write (CWE-20) in the Native Wi-Fi driver nwifi.sys. On the receive path (Pt6Receive -> ExtSTARecvInitializeMSDUFromNBL -> ExtSTAReceivePacket -> ExtSTAReceiveDataPacket), Dot11Translate80211ToEthernetNdisPacket translates 802.11 frames to Ethernet in place. It validates the 8-byte LLC/SNAP header length, but when LLC type == 0x8100 (802.1Q VLAN) the extra 4-byte 802.1Q header follows and the pre-patch code did NOT verify those 4 bytes are present before reading them and deriving the Ethernet-header write offset - so a frame claiming VLAN with no VLAN payload reads the VLAN header OOB and (case 4: type 0x8100 && vlanid>=0x600, v17=LLC_off-0xE+4+8) writes the Ethernet header past the MDL buffer. Reachable from any device on the same Wi-Fi network (rogue AP / open net), no auth. IN-HOUSE ghidriff of nwifi.sys 10.0.22621.3527 -> .3733 (Jun 11 2024, the exact Crowdfense versions) confirms the fix: the 0x8100 branch adds `if (available < data_length + 0xc) goto bail` before reading the VLAN header, ensuring the extra 4 bytes fit. Length check reads unconditional (the Feature_1281542463 flag in the same build gates unrelated selective-translation work). Credit: aleksandr.k & voidsec (Crowdfense).

Attack Path
An 802.11 frame claiming a VLAN header it doesn't carry makes nwifi read/write past the packet buffer while building the Ethernet header
Derived from the patch delta: the checks added by the vendor identify which fields crossed a trust boundary unvalidated. Reachability and privilege are taken from the call chain in the RCA report.
